Overview for PSC 7H20

PSC Code 7H20 covers hardware, software, and related equipment essential for database management, mainframe operations, and middleware platforms within IT and telecommunications. This category primarily includes local database instances, distributed platforms, and integration resources that facilitate cross-application development, communication, and information sharing among systems. The PSC applies to both hardware components and perpetual license software, which grants indefinite use rights to government agencies. Agencies utilize this PSC to procure robust, scalable database and middleware solutions that support mission-critical applications and systems integration on mainframe and distributed computing environments.

Includes for PSC 7H20

This PSC code covers the following products and services:

Mainframe database and middleware products and tools. Software that is licensed for use indefinitely. This can also be referred to as perpetual, indefinite, permanent, continuous, or ever lasting.

Typical Buyers & Agencies for PSC 7H20

Federal agencies with substantial IT infrastructure needs, such as the Department of Defense, Department of Veterans Affairs, and large civilian agencies like the General Services Administration, commonly procure under PSC 7H20. These buyers require durable and scalable database and middleware technology to support extensive data processing, legacy mainframe systems, and integration across diverse applications. The PSC supports their need for reliable, long-term software licenses and hardware solutions that sustain critical government operations and compliance with data management standards.

Common Contract Types for PSC 7H20

Contracts under PSC 7H20 typically include firm-fixed-price, indefinite delivery/indefinite quantity (IDIQ), and multiple-award task orders to accommodate variable demand for database and middleware products. Procurement methods often involve competitive bidding and GSA Schedule contracts to leverage pre-negotiated terms for perpetual software licenses and hardware acquisitions. Use cases include modernization initiatives, system upgrades, and ongoing maintenance of mainframe and distributed database environments, reflecting a strategic investment in durable IT infrastructure.
